I read the German version of this article a while ago, and it said that there was a German adaptation of the scripts written by Harry Rowohlt and Sven Böttcher that were released on CD. I went to the German Amazon and it's true, there are.

Should this be incorporated into the article, perhaps retitling the "BBC Radio adaptation" section to "Modern radio adaptations" and adding a few lines? The trouble is I can't find any other sources other than the Amazon link (and that I actually bought one but I can't read the sleeve!). Or is it not notable enough for inclusion? Professor Biegel of Yale Law School edit

This search shows a 1938 reference indicating that complaints were received from a Professor Biegel of Yale Law School. The article cites a 2000 reference and says it was a New York attorney named Morris Beagle. -- Uzma Gamal (talk) 10:45, 28 November 2010 (UTC)Reply
